Position Summary:
The Talent Development and Learning Manager will lead the design and deployment of talent and learning initiatives for salaried and non-technician employees. Reporting directly to the CHRO, this individual will play a crucial role in HR transformation, ensuring the successful implementation and adoption of a full cycle performance management process, coaching and feedback, individual development plans, learning & career paths, and leadership development initiatives.

Primary Responsibilities:
* Lead the design, implementation, and maintenance of talent processes, including performance management, talent reviews, individual development, leadership development, learning & career paths, and engagement initiatives.

* Own the performance management and talent review processes, ensuring their effectiveness and relevance to organizational needs.

* Deploy talent programs and initiatives, including goal setting, year-end performance reviews, regular check-in conversations, performance improvement plans, 360-degree feedback, succession plans, and talent retention action items.

* Design and deploy individual development plans and career paths for employees, providing ongoing support and guidance on progress.

* Oversee and administer leadership development programs, focusing on coaching, feedback, growth and retention.

About Us: Founded in 1948, Cleveland Brothers Equipment Co., Inc., is the exclusive Cat dealer of western and central Pennsylvania, northern West Virginia and western Maryland, providing new, used and rental equipment, parts and service.

Cleveland Brothers supplies a vast variety of solutions and products, including construction machinery, industrial diesel and gas engines and generators, air compressors and boosters, oil and gas machinery and much more, in addition to full truck service for all makes and models.
